What they do
A Real Estate Agent works with clients to help them buy, sell or rent property. Works with and represents either a buyer or a seller in real estate transactions, and specializes in residential, commercial or other types of property. Offers clients up to date knowledge of local communities, real estate markets and prices. May be licensed to operate a real estate business.
